Etymology edit

From the root ゆた (yuta), whence (ゆた) (yutaka). Compare (ほそ) (hosoi) and ほっそり (hossori); (あさ) (asai) and あっさり (assari); (さわ)やか (sawayaka)(historically さはやか (safayaka)) and さっぱり (sappari); ()びる (nobiru), ()() (nobinobi), ()びやか (nobiyaka), and のんびり (nonbiri).
